St Mary and All Saints, Kirkby Underwood

 

​The Village

The PCC and Village Hall committees collaborate on major fundraising activities like the Summer Fayre, Open Gardens, and Annual Produce Show. Most events are held in the Village Hall, which the Church uses for free, but occasionally the Church building is used for additional fundraising. The PCC publishes a free monthly newsletter delivered to all houses in the village, detailing village events and news.​

The Church

The Parish Church of St. Mary and All Saints stands at the end of its own  lane, some quarter of a mile to the West of the village, which once surrounded it.
The church is a Grade 1 listed building dating from the 13th century. The Church has a full set of vestments and seasonal banners. The building and churchyard are well maintained.

The PCC is a member of the Church Repair Society of the Diocese of Lincoln, contributing financially to each Quinquennial Inspection. Following a theft of lead from the roof in 2011, the south and north nave roofs were replaced with turn coated stainless steel. St Mary’s has four working bells, rung before special services and the bell ringers practice weekly.
